[gimp] libgimp: remove gimp_register_magic_load_handler()



commit 2599d79292d04665569f958e4f46c288ff3f985b
Author: Michael Natterer <mitch gimp org>
Date:   Tue Aug 27 14:48:08 2019 +0200

    libgimp: remove gimp_register_magic_load_handler()

 libgimp/gimp.def     |  1 -
 libgimp/gimplegacy.c | 26 --------------------------
 libgimp/gimplegacy.h |  4 ----
 3 files changed, 31 deletions(-)
---
diff --git a/libgimp/gimp.def b/libgimp/gimp.def
index c3232b395e..d5e6140ac2 100644
--- a/libgimp/gimp.def
+++ b/libgimp/gimp.def
@@ -749,7 +749,6 @@ EXPORTS
        gimp_progress_update
        gimp_quit
        gimp_register_file_handler_mime
-       gimp_register_magic_load_handler
        gimp_register_save_handler
        gimp_run_procedure_array
        gimp_save_procedure_get_type
diff --git a/libgimp/gimplegacy.c b/libgimp/gimplegacy.c
index 73bed2f8ea..f1344d6cbf 100644
--- a/libgimp/gimplegacy.c
+++ b/libgimp/gimplegacy.c
@@ -392,32 +392,6 @@ gimp_plugin_menu_register (const gchar *procedure_name,
   return _gimp_plugin_menu_register (procedure_name, menu_path);
 }
 
-/**
- * gimp_register_magic_load_handler:
- * @procedure_name: The name of the procedure to be used for loading.
- * @extensions: comma separated list of extensions this handler can load (i.e. "jpg,jpeg").
- * @prefixes: comma separated list of prefixes this handler can load (i.e. "http:,ftp:").
- * @magics: comma separated list of magic file information this handler can load (i.e. "0,string,GIF").
- *
- * Registers a file load handler procedure.
- *
- * Registers a procedural database procedure to be called to load files
- * of a particular file format using magic file information.
- *
- * Returns: TRUE on success.
- **/
-gboolean
-gimp_register_magic_load_handler (const gchar *procedure_name,
-                                  const gchar *extensions,
-                                  const gchar *prefixes,
-                                  const gchar *magics)
-{
-  ASSERT_NO_PLUG_IN_EXISTS (G_STRFUNC);
-
-  return _gimp_register_magic_load_handler (procedure_name,
-                                            extensions, prefixes, magics);
-}
-
 /**
  * gimp_register_save_handler:
  * @procedure_name: The name of the procedure to be used for saving.
diff --git a/libgimp/gimplegacy.h b/libgimp/gimplegacy.h
index 7c0aba3736..01ab108e23 100644
--- a/libgimp/gimplegacy.h
+++ b/libgimp/gimplegacy.h
@@ -268,10 +268,6 @@ gboolean   gimp_plugin_menu_register        (const gchar   *procedure_name,
 /* gimp_fileops API that should now be done by using GimpFileProcedure
  */
 
-gboolean   gimp_register_magic_load_handler    (const gchar *procedure_name,
-                                                const gchar *extensions,
-                                                const gchar *prefixes,
-                                                const gchar *magics);
 gboolean   gimp_register_save_handler          (const gchar *procedure_name,
                                                 const gchar *extensions,
                                                 const gchar *prefixes);


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]